In these last days of May, we pray the novena to the Holy Spirit (May 30-June 7), in preparation for Pentecost. And it’s useful to reflect on what the Holy Spirit did for the Blessed Virgin Mary, making her both Mother of Jesus and Mother of the Church.  By this approach, we cap our honoring of Mary during her month of May. We honor the Holy Spirit, and we honor also all Christians who have taken seriously the work of the Holy Spirit after the example of Mary.

All of Mary’s greatness as a Christian is owing to the fact that the Holy Spirit came upon her, and that she lived in the presence of God, continuously aware of His presence in her life.  Our Lady cooperated with the Spirit’s promptings in loving obedience to God’s Word; she daily renewed her fiat at the Annunciation.  Mary the Virgin heeded the Lord’s plan for her and thus became fruitful. …
